Instructions
For the marinade: Place all the ingredients in a bowl and mix well. Place the chicken pieces in the marinade and coat. Leave for at least 20 minutes, but a few hours is ideal.
For the sauce: In a bowl or jug, mix the cornflour and water first to combine. Then add the remaining ingredients and combine well. Set aside.

Bring a large saucepan of water to the boil. Add the soba noodles and cook for 3 minutes (or according to packet instructions). Drain and set aside.

Place a large frying pan over medium heat. Add the chicken pieces and cook each side for about 5–6 minutes, or until cooked through. Remove and set aside. Wipe out the pan if charred.

Place the same pan back over high heat. Add the oil and let it heat. Add the mushrooms and cook, stirring, for 2–3 minutes until they colour. Add the broccolini pieces and stir through for 2 minutes. Then add the snow peas and edamame. Pour the sauce into the pan and stir through over high heat for 1–2 minutes. Turn off the heat. Gently stir through the soba noodles.

Divide the soba noodles and veggies among bowls. Slice the chicken thighs and place on top. Sprinkle over the sesame seeds and spring onion, if desired.
